The Applicant sought to have a separation agreement made a final order, retroactive application of the order, findings of breach against the Respondent, and financial penalties.
The Respondent filed a cross-motion for costs.
The court granted the request to make the separation agreement a final order but denied retroactive application.
It found the Respondent breached communication and ancillary terms of the agreement but declined to impose financial penalties under Rule 1(8) as the agreement was not yet a court order.
The court also denied the Respondent's request for costs for a previous ex-parte motion.
Further submissions on a temporary enforcement order and costs for the current motion were directed.
